View venue Artist or maker Peter Paul Rubens 1577–1640 View profile War and Victory Victoria and Albert Museum WebApr 11, 2024 · At issue is the work presented to the public as the original Samson and Delilah, painted by Peter Paul Rubens in 1609. It was bought by the Gallery at a Christie’s auction in 1980 for £2.5 million: a modest sum now, but it was the most the Gallery had ever paid for a painting and a near record for any Old Master transaction.
